Understanding HMB: A Key Muscle Metabolite
Beta-hydroxy-beta-methylbutyrate, or HMB, is a metabolite of the essential branched-chain amino acid, leucine. Its primary role is to reduce muscle protein breakdown (anti-catabolic) while also supporting muscle protein synthesis (anabolic), leading to more efficient muscle turnover. This dual action makes it a popular supplement among athletes and fitness enthusiasts, particularly those in intense training phases or those aiming to preserve lean muscle mass during a calorie deficit. HMB has also shown benefits in promoting muscle mass and strength in untrained and older adults.
The Two Forms of HMB: Calcium Salt vs. Free Acid
When considering your HMB timing, it's essential to recognize that not all HMB supplements are the same. The two primary forms available are Calcium HMB (HMB-Ca) and Free Acid HMB (HMB-FA). Their chemical structures directly influence how they are absorbed by the body, which, in turn, dictates the optimal time to take them and whether food is a factor.
Calcium HMB (CaHMB) and Food Absorption
As the more common, powder or capsule form, HMB-Ca is bound to a calcium salt. This structure leads to a slower, more gradual release into the bloodstream compared to its free-acid counterpart. Research shows that HMB-Ca takes significantly longer to reach peak plasma concentration—up to 128 minutes. Because its absorption is slower and steadier, the presence of food has a less dramatic impact on its overall effectiveness. In fact, many people find that taking HMB-Ca with meals helps to reduce any potential gastrointestinal discomfort, such as an upset stomach or bloating, which can sometimes occur with supplements. This makes spreading your HMB-Ca dose throughout the day with your meals a highly effective and comfortable strategy for maintaining consistent blood levels.
Free Acid HMB (HMB-FA) and Fasted Absorption
In contrast, HMB-FA is a liquid or gel form that is not bound to a mineral salt. This allows for a much faster absorption rate, with peak plasma levels occurring in as little as 30-60 minutes. The speed of absorption is a key advantage for pre-workout timing. However, its fast-acting nature also means it can be sensitive to the presence of food. Taking HMB-FA with carbohydrates, in particular, may delay its peak availability. For this reason, many experts recommend taking HMB-FA on an empty stomach or with a light, non-carbohydrate meal 30-60 minutes before your workout to get the fastest possible absorption and highest peak blood levels.
HMB Timing and Absorption: A Comparison
To highlight the key differences, consider this comparison table:
| Aspect | HMB Free Acid (HMB-FA) | Calcium HMB (HMB-Ca) | 
|---|---|---|
| Peak Absorption | Fast (~30-60 min) | Slower (~128 min) | 
| Food Impact | Food, especially carbs, can delay absorption. | Minimal impact on overall absorption, can reduce stomach upset. | 
| Best Pre-Workout Timing | 30-60 minutes before exercise. | 60-120 minutes before exercise to account for slower absorption. | 
| Ideal Usage | Rapid pre-workout boost, potentially on an empty stomach. | Consistent daily dosing, often with meals, to maintain steady levels. | 
Strategic Timing for Your HMB Supplement
Beyond the choice of HMB form, the best time to take your supplement depends on your training schedule and personal preference.
- Pre-Workout: Taking HMB before a workout is a popular strategy to prepare muscles for stress and minimize damage. If using HMB-FA, take it 30-60 minutes prior. For HMB-Ca, allow more time, ideally 60-120 minutes beforehand.
- Post-Workout: A dose immediately after exercise can help replenish HMB levels and support muscle recovery processes. This is a particularly good strategy for HMB-Ca, which provides a steady supply of HMB to aid in the recovery phase.
- Splitting Doses: Most research indicates a daily dosage of around 3 grams, often split into 2-3 servings of 1 gram each. Dividing the dose throughout the day, especially with HMB-Ca, helps maintain consistently elevated blood levels, which enhances its overall effectiveness.
- On Non-Training Days: Consistency is key for HMB supplementation to be effective. Continue taking your daily dose on rest days to keep HMB levels saturated, aiding in ongoing muscle maintenance and recovery.
The Importance of Consistent Dosing
Regardless of the form or specific timing, the true benefits of HMB are cumulative and dependent on consistent, long-term use. For best results, consistent daily supplementation for at least two weeks is necessary to saturate HMB levels and experience optimal results. This is because HMB's role is not just about acute performance but about reducing muscle breakdown over a longer period. Research shows that benefits are more pronounced after several weeks of continuous use.
Potential Side Effects and Interactions
HMB is generally considered safe and well-tolerated at the standard dosage of 3 grams per day, with few reported side effects. The most common issues are mild gastrointestinal distress, such as gas or bloating, which can be minimized by taking the supplement with food. As always, consulting a healthcare professional before starting any new supplement is recommended, especially if you have pre-existing health conditions. Conclusion: Your Optimal HMB Timing Depends on the Form
The question of whether to take HMB with or without food ultimately depends on the type of HMB you are using and your goals. If you opt for the fast-acting Free Acid (HMB-FA) form, taking it on an empty stomach pre-workout is ideal for rapid peak absorption. For the more common Calcium HMB (HMB-Ca), taking it with food is not only fine but can help manage stomach issues while maintaining consistent blood levels throughout the day. The most crucial factor, regardless of timing or form, is consistency in daily intake to ensure your body has adequate HMB to support your muscle goals.
